Transaction 66e1f6d2db1ec3cc3095f446a16697090d1ecdc626553e8aff628c93f999f66b
1 Input
1 Output
-
66e1f6d2db1ec3cc3095f446a16697090d1ecdc626553e8aff628c93f999f66b:0
- value
- 569249
- script pubkey
- OP_0 OP_PUSHBYTES_32 fd655fe2f3ccd149f3515150ca4650b8f090b7c224173c71cebe01cb777d10af
- address
- bc1ql4j4lchneng5nu6329gv53jshrcfpd7zystncuwwhcqukamazzhstd3ge4